Today I used a vintage Shulton Old Spice shaving cream which performed as I expected but not as I had hoped. I am not sure of the age of the product but I believe it to be from the 1950s. From the tube the cream appeared like a nutty brown sludge containing some crystal like material. The smell was strong vintage Old Spice but it did not last. I usually face lather but decided to use a bowl as I was unsure of the properties of the cream. It performed poorly producing a very thin lather which dissipated quickly with almost no slickness although it was not drying at all and the face feel after shaving was good. My experience is that soaps, especially triple milled, can often perform well even when decades old but with creams this is not usually the case. My question is, can I resurrect this cream in some way or re-purpose it so as to make some use of the great scent? Thanks.
